i checked the numbers on a t5 i purchased. it is rated at 265ft/lbs. 1352-169
should this be fattened up. im building a strong engine and my goal will be 4oohp.

A z-spec T5 with a reinforced counter gear stabilizer will get you up near the 400 hp mark. The question is how will you be driving and what kind of rear tires are you looking at?? If you are drag racing with slicks than the only option is G-force, but if you are only a street driver who will occasionally dump the clutch than a Z-spec will work just fine.

Geforce offers a few different ratios I think, their rebuild kit is around $1,000 and replaces the mainshaft, all the gear clusters etc, plus all the other basic stuff for a rebuild.
